Prognostic value of lymphocyte subsets in diffuse large B cell lymphoma

Summary
Prognosis in diffuse large B cell lymphoma (DLBCL) can be improved by analyzing lymphocyte subsets. A higher CD4+/CD8+ ratio in patients with DLBCL indicates a better prognosis and longer survival.

Background:
- Clinical outcomes for diffuse large B cell lymphoma (DLBCL) remain unpredictable despite identified prognostic parameters.
- Lymphocyte subpopulations are recognized as potential prognostic factors for DLBCL, but existing research has limitations due to small sample sizes and conflicting findings.
Purpose of the Study:
- To investigate the relationship between lymphocyte subsets and prognosis prediction in newly diagnosed DLBCL patients.
- To evaluate the potential of lymphocyte subsets, particularly the CD4+/CD8+ ratio, as prognostic indicators for DLBCL.
Main Methods:
- Retrospective analysis of 301 newly diagnosed DLBCL patients treated between January 2015 and December 2019.
- Correlation analysis of lymphocyte subsets with clinical features and treatment response (R-CHOP).
- Kaplan-Meier analysis to assess the association between CD4+/CD8+ ratio and progression-free survival (PFS) and overall survival (OS).
Main Results:
- Patients with more severe DLBCL exhibited lower CD19+ B cells, CD4+ T cells, and CD4+/CD8+ ratio, with higher CD8+ T cells.
- Significant associations were found between lymphocyte subsets and clinical parameters like Ann Arbor stage, IPI score, LDH, b2-MG, Ki-67, age, and neutrophils.
- A higher CD4+/CD8+ ratio at diagnosis predicted a good response to R-CHOP, longer PFS, and OS, with a low CD4+/CD8+ ratio independently associated with worse PFS.
Conclusions:
- Lymphocyte subsets, especially the CD4+/CD8+ ratio, can serve as valuable prognostic indicators for DLBCL.
- The CD4+/CD8+ ratio may be recommended for routine clinical use in predicting DLBCL prognosis.
- Further research can explore integrating lymphocyte subset analysis into standard DLBCL prognostic assessments.
